Function generators and associated multiplexers in 7 series FPGAs can implement these functions:
- 4:1 multiplexers using one LUT
- Four 4:1 MUXes per slice
- 8:1 multiplexers using two LUTs
- Two 8:1 MUXes per slice
- 16:1 multiplexers using four LUTs
- One 16:1 MUX per slice
These wide input multiplexers are implemented in one level of logic (or LUT) using the dedicated F7AMUX, F7BMUX, and F8MUX multiplexers. These multiplexers allow LUT combinations of up to four LUTs in a slice. The wide multiplexers can also be used to create general-purpose functions of up to 13 inputs in two LUTs or 27 inputs in four LUTs (one slice). Although the multiplexer outputs are combinatorial, they can be registered in the CLB storage elements.
